in temp control, it doesn't produce much vapor and I have it set to 200w and 450f.

My question is, it's set to .02ohm. How can I up the ohms to match my coil. I'm guessing that's why it's not producing

How's it going? .02 Ohms?? You sure it's not .20 ohms? What Atty is it or is it a custom wrap and is it Ni200, Stainless, or Titanium?? A friend and I figured out a trick on my RX200. For example the RX200 at 400F and at 60 watts with my smok TCT using Ni200 .15 ohm coil. Make sure that you're on the Ni setting and that you locked the resistance. When I first fire it vapor production is poor. I will fire it again. Then I will unlock resistance and unscrew the atty so when I fire it reads "No atomizer", then quickly tread it back on and press the fire button once. It should say "New Atomizer Yes or No?" Select Yes "+ button" and you ohms should be about .19 ohms. Lock resistance and vape. You should see a major difference on vapor production. On TC you're ok within plus or minus of 4-5. For example if the TC coil is .15 ohm get it to .19 to .20 ohms you will be fine. This works on Ni200, Stainless and Titanium. So for my Uwell Crown .25 Stainless coils, I'll raise the ohm value between .28 and .29 ohms. The vapor and taste is stellar!

Hope this helps. On the DNA 200 version you can setup 8 different profiles, so you don't have to do this trick. But I only recommend a DNA 200 for very advanced vapors. Happy New Year!!
